Am I hearing right? It sounds like Randy gave the win to the GT500. Skip to 11:30
ZL1: + "far superior brakes" - more understeer through a middle of a corner + on a bumpy road, the Camaro is going to take it + more sophisticated suspension - chassis imbalance (understeer, then oversteer) - "push loose" GT500: + Best bite, best steering - needs a brake upgrade for track work + Better car with a brake upgrade for track work and probably the street too + Better balanced + "really puts the power down" Thoughts? |
